Key Features of the Best Veterinary Websites

To create a successful veterinary website in 2026, certain features must be prioritized. Here are some key elements that the best veterinary websites share:

1. **User-Friendly Navigation**: A clean, intuitive layout that allows users to find information quickly. 2. **Mobile Responsiveness**: Websites must function seamlessly on smartphones and tablets. 3. **Online Appointment Scheduling**: An essential feature that allows pet owners to book appointments directly through the website. 4. **Informative Blog Section**: Regularly updated content that provides valuable information to pet owners, positioning the practice as a trusted resource. 5. **Client Testimonials**: Showcasing positive feedback from clients to build credibility and trust. 6. **Social Media Integration**: Links to social media platforms help to engage clients and create a community around the practice. 7. **Telehealth Options**: Offering virtual consultations to accommodate busy pet owners or those unable to visit in person. 8. **E-commerce Capabilities**: A section for selling pet products and medications directly from the website. 9. **Live Chat Support**: Instant communication options help address pet owners' questions in real-time.

Design and Aesthetic Trends for Veterinary Websites in 2026

Design trends play a crucial role in the effectiveness of a veterinary website. The following aesthetic elements are trending in 2026:

1. **Minimalist Design**: Clean lines and a clutter-free layout enhance user experience. 2. **Bold Typography**: Attention-grabbing fonts help convey messages clearly. 3. **Bright Colors**: Vibrant color schemes attract visitors and convey a sense of warmth and friendliness. 4. **High-Quality Images**: Professional photography of pets and the veterinary team creates a personal connection. 5. **Video Content**: Short videos explaining services or showcasing client testimonials increase engagement. 6. **Dynamic Content**: Interactive quizzes or tools to help pet owners assess their pets' health needs can enhance user engagement.

SEO Strategies for Veterinary Websites

In 2026, effective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is paramount for veterinary websites. Here are some strategies to consider:

1. **Keyword Optimization**: Integrate relevant keywords, such as "best veterinary website 2026," throughout the site. 2. **Local SEO**: Optimize for local searches by including location-based keywords and creating a Google My Business profile. 3. **Quality Content Creation**: Regularly update the blog with articles that address common pet health questions and concerns. 4. **Backlink Building**: Collaborate with local pet businesses or influencers to generate backlinks to your site. 5. **User Experience**: Ensure fast loading times and easy navigation to improve dwell time and reduce bounce rates. 6. **Analytics Tracking**: Utilize tools like Google Analytics to monitor traffic and user behavior, adjusting strategies accordingly.
